Why was the industrial revolution seen as both a blessing and a curse?

It was seen as a curse for the working class because of the working conditions. (they had lots of fires with no way out, toxins, little kids working dangerous machinery, etc) and it was a blessing because it sparked a growth in Europe along with a growth in power.


How did the Industrial Revolution proved to be a mixed blessing?

both. it was a blessing because it brought advances in medicine, helped with new directions in science, gave us women's rights, and sped up transportation and communication. it was a curse because it polluted the air, took jobs from farmers (work was replaced by faster and more efficient machines), and the poor had to live in row homes that were very crowded.
